Transaction de9396e4bef3f8657d71daad48c3c2134394a0d3404a8f6f59d0935663636389
1 Input
1 Output
-
de9396e4bef3f8657d71daad48c3c2134394a0d3404a8f6f59d0935663636389:0
- value
- 655075031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cc380a90ab3e090a27e6120b960ec2df3bd0bdb OP_EQUAL
- address
- 3FyuYE6iTHf6JGFcJT2o2VgX1tf7SYR7yC